How they compare
Marshall Islands currently reports 21.05 million constant US$ against 20.69 million constant US$ in Cuba, a difference of 0.36 million constant US$.
The two have swapped places 7 times across 24 shared years of data; in 2001 it was Cuba ahead.
Cuba ranks 110th and Marshall Islands ranks 109th of 132 countries.
Across the 3 decades both report, Cuba averaged higher in 2 and Marshall Islands in 1.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Cuba | Marshall Islands |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 13.09 million constant US$ | 23.9 million constant US$ | 10.81 million constant US$ | Marshall Islands |
| 2010s | 13.41 million constant US$ | 9.14 million constant US$ | 4.27 million constant US$ | Cuba |
| 2020s | 21.44 million constant US$ | 15.82 million constant US$ | 5.61 million constant US$ | Cuba |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
